PHP性能最优化
PHP 性能优化技巧php代码优化方法
1.$row['id']的效率是$row的7倍。
2.在执行for循环之前确定最大循环数,不要每循环一次都计算最大值。尽量不要在for循环中使用函数,比如for ($x=0; $x < count($array); $x)每循环一次都会调用count()函数。
3.require_once比require慢3-4倍,应该尽量使用require/include。
4.注销那些不用的变量尤其是大数组,以便释放内存。
5.当操作字符串并需要检验其长度是否满足某种要求时,if (!isset($foo{5}))比if (strlen($foo) < 5)效率高
6.用@屏蔽错误消息的做法非常低效
7.字符串替换函数效率高->低 str_replace(), strtr(), preg_replace()
8.不建议非静态方法的静态调用url
页:
[1]